Restoring Classic Cars

There's a certain allure to classic cars—a bygone era of craftsmanship and design that captures the imagination. For enthusiasts, renovation is more than just a hobby; it's a passion project fueled by nostalgia and the desire to preserve automotive history. These journeys often involve meticulous research into the car's origins, gathering of original parts, and painstaking work to bring it back to its former glory. From gleaming chrome bumpers to deep paint jobs, each detail is carefully recreated, revealing the car's story and respecting its legacy.

The process itself is a blend of knowledge and commitment. Engineers often delve into intricate details, while artisans painstakingly restore leather interiors and reupholster faded fabrics. The result is a car that not only runs but also tells the tale of its past, becoming a cherished symbol of automotive history in motion.

Automotive Styling: The Fusion of Creativity and Technology

In the dynamic realm of automotive design, a harmonious convergence exists between artistic expression and rigorous engineering. Skilled designers shape vehicles that are not only visually captivating but also possess exceptional performance and durability. The refined contours of a car's exterior, frequently inspired by aerodynamic principles, reduce air resistance, improving fuel efficiency.

Furthermore, the interior design aims to create a pleasant and ergonomic environment for the driver and passengers. Innovative materials employed to enhance both the aesthetic appeal and the functional aspects of the cabin.
